Acer announces two Windows 8 tablets from $799

Acer Iconia W510

Acer has announced two of their Windows 8 tablets that will be launched in the third quarter of this year, around the time when Microsoft will officially launch Windows 8. The two tablets Acer announced are Iconia W510 and Iconia W700.

Iconia W510 sports a 10.1-inch IPS HD display and will be launched at a price of $799. Acer offers a detachable keyboard dock for the tablet with a built-in battery. While connected to the keyboard dock, the tablet can give battery life of up to 18 hours. The dock can also work as a stand, it can be rotated to 295 degrees so that it can be used for presentations, watching videos and more.

Iconia W700 has a 11.6-inch full HD display with Dolby audio. It comes with a multipurpose cradle that gives you several viewing options, but unlike W510 it does not come with a keyboard dock, though you can attach via USB. The tablets also has 3 USB 3.0 ports and microHDMI. Iconia W700 will be priced for $999 at the time of launch.
